The Keepers of the Law – Part 30
So, this is Bible Truth:
Once we are saved, we/us/I are in the SPIRIT. They are no longer IN the flesh. That is SOUND DOCTRINE.
A saved person still deals with his/her flesh. They are at war. BUT THEY ARE COMPLETELY 2 SEPARATE PERSONS!
Some say that the FLESH is not the same thing as the BODY, I disagree.
Combined “flesh” and “bod,,” are in The Bible over 700 times. I have seen ALL of them. There is really NOTHING that says the words are not completely interchangeable. Here is an example passage…
1Co 15:35 But some man will say, How are the dead raised up? and with what body do they come?
This is talking specifically about THE BODY of a human.
1Co 15:36 Thou fool, that which thou sowest is not quickened, except it die:
He is making a comparison to planting something DEAD (a seed) and having a new pant grow.
1Co 15:37 And that which thou sowest (plant/bury), thou sowest not that body that shall be, but bare grain, it may chance of wheat, or of some other grain:
In other words you don’t plant the living plant – or you didn’t get anything NEW. It was just the same plant! You plant the dead seed – so you get a NEW plant to grow! This happened when you were conceived and when you were born a NEW person!
1Co 15:38 But God giveth it a body as it hath pleased him, and to every seed his own body.
So, this whole time we have been talkig about the body. Now He makes a switcheroo…
1Co 15:39 All flesh is not the same flesh: but there is one kind of flesh of men, another flesh of beasts, another of fishes, and another of birds.
1Co 15:40 There are also celestial bodies, and bodies terrestrial: but the glory of the celestial is one, and the glory of the terrestrial is another.
1Co 15:41 There is one glory of the sun, and another glory of the moon, and another glory of the stars: for one star differeth from another star in glory.
Now, He gets to the point!!!
1Co 15:42 So also is the resurrection of the dead. It is sown in corruption; it is raised in incorruption:
The “flesh”, the “body” is SOWN (planted/buried) “in corruption”: Dead, Corrupt, SinFULL.
The “flesh”, the “body” is RAISED (born/raised up NEW) “in INcorruption”: Alive, INcorruptible, SinLESS.
1Co 15:43 It is sown in dishonour; it is raised in glory: it is sown in weakness; it is raised in power:
THIS BODY, THIS FLESH the we have now, is dead, sinful, corrupt, dishonoured, weak. And it will NOT last forever.
1Co 15:44 It is sown a natural body; it is raised a spiritual body. There is a natural body, and there is a spiritual body.
This is why Jesus HAD to come. Adam, and his type of “obedience”, produces nothing but death. Adam was disobedient.
1Co 15:45 And so it is written, The first man Adam was made a living soul; the last Adam was made a quickening spirit.
Jesus was obedient. And no other man in history ever was competely obedient without sin. None.
1Co 15:46 Howbeit that was not first which is spiritual, but that which is natural; and afterward that which is spiritual.
1Co 15:47 The first man is of the earth, earthy: the second man is the Lord from heaven.
1Co 15:48 As is the earthy, such are they also that are earthy: and as is the heavenly, such are they also that are heavenly.
1Co 15:49 And as we have borne the image of the earthy, we shall also bear the image of the heavenly.
1Co 15:50 Now this I say, brethren, that flesh and blood cannot inherit the kingdom of God; neither doth corruption inherit incorruption.
What does this last phrase mean? It means this…
Job_14:4 Who can bring a clean thing out of an unclean? not one.
It is impossible. Once you die UNCLEAN, you are UNCLEAN forever.
Rev 22:11 He that is unjust, let him be unjust still: and he which is filthy (unclean), let him be filthy still: and he that is righteous, let him be righteous still: and he that is holy, let him be holy still.
There is a LINE between CLEAN and UNCLEAN. You are one or the other. Not both.
